Overview

Postcode S66 8LR is located in an urban city, within the Hellaby & Maltby West ward of Rotherham in the Yorkshire and The Humber region, and forms part of the Maltby West & Hellaby area. It has high deprivation and high crime levels, with around 74.2 crimes per 1,000 residents per year, about 34% below the Yorkshire and The Humber average of 113 per 1,000. The average income per household in Maltby West & Hellaby is £49,112 per year. The nearest station is Conisbrough, about 4.6 miles away. There are 3 primary and 1 secondary schools in the area.

Deprivation level

8/10

Maltby West & Hellaby has a high level of deprivation, ranked at position 8,219 out of 32,844 areas in the United Kingdom, placing it within the top 25% most deprived areas in England.

Crime level

7/10

Maltby West & Hellaby has a high crime rate, with approximately 74.2 reported incidents per 1,000 population each year.

Social housing

21.2%

Approximately 21.2% of homes on this street are social housing provided by a local council or housing association. Across the surrounding area, around 8.6% of dwellings are socially rented.

Income level

6/10

The average income per household in Maltby West & Hellaby is £49,112 per year.

Noise Level

Moderate

Moderate noise level (65.0-69.9 dB) from road, approximately 230 ft away from S66 8LR.

Flood risk

No risk

Maltby West & Hellaby near S66 8LR has no flood risk (less than 0.1% chance of a flood each year) from rivers and sea.

Transport

The nearest station is Conisbrough located about 4.6 miles away. There are no other stations nearby.
